Abstract:
O presente artigo trata-se de uma revisão bibliográfica referente à rinomodelação e sua relação com a oclusão vascular devido ao uso de ácido hialurônico. Os procedimentos estéticos estão inseridos na sociedade desde a antiguidade, mas nos últimos anos a busca por procedimentos com acido hialurônico vem crescendo por todo o mundo. O preenchimento com AH é considerado seguro e com baixa incidência de complicações, apesar de a rinomodelação ser considerada como um dos procedimentos de mais riscos devido à vasculatura da região. Como tais eventos adversos são raros ou tem sido sub-relatados são de extrema importância o conhecimento e mais informações para identificá-los, administra-los e tratá-los da maneira correta. O foco desse artigo foi destacar a problemática da injeção intra- arterial, seus sinais e sintomas, fatores de riscos, manejo da intercorrência e possíveis tratamentos. Foi possível compreender que a maioria dos casos de oclusão vascular estão relacionados com a falta de experiência com a técnica ou pela falta de conhecimento anatômico.

Abstract:
The correction of imperfections in the nasal dorsum and attached structures with hyaluronic acid (HA) has become common because it is less invasive and a quick recovery procedure. Hyaluronic acid is the product of choice for rhinomodeling procedures, because it is moldable, it allows us to restructure the skin of the nose area, giving us immediate results, which can be reversed with the use of hyaluronidase. Given the above, this work aims to present a clinical case of rhinomodeling using hyaluronic acid. Female patient, sought care with a complaint regarding the tip of the nose, as she considered it “fallen”. To perform the rhinomodeling, we use hyaluronic acid at the points defined in the planning. Two orifices were used and the filled areas were the columella, base of the columella and the point of the nose. The patient was satisfied with the immediate result. It is concluded that rhinomodeling with hyaluronic acid provides immediate and satisfactory effects, being in the correction of small defects or improving the result of surgical rhinoplasties.

Abstract:
ABSTRACTIntroductionNonsurgical rhinoplasty or rhinomodelation is a sought‐after procedure in aesthetic practice. The current product of choice remains hyaluronic acid (HA) because of its ease of use and reversibility. However, it does carry some risks. Polycaprolactone (PCL) fillers hold a lot of promise in aesthetic practice. It has an established safety profile and a longer duration of action. Because of its unique properties, it may hold the key to the future of nonsurgical rhinomodelation.MethodsTwelve patients were enrolled in the study. Ten out of these were not willing to ask for surgery and had no breathing problems. Two were post‐surgical rhinoplasty complications who did not want another surgery. 0.2 mL of PCL filler was injected at each site according to the need (radix, spine, and or tip). The Global Aesthetic Improvement Scale (GAIS; 3 = very much improved, 2 = considerably improved, 1 = improved, 0 = no change, and −1 = worse) was used along with a patient satisfaction scale (highly satisfied, satisfied, dissatisfied) were used. The sum of the GAIS ratings was quantified as total improvement (TMI). The patients were followed up for 12 months before and 12 months after procedures were taken and documented.ResultsThe GAIS score was 98% for the study and all patients were highly satisfied with their treatment right after procedure and 12 months later.ConclusionPCL fillers may be the way forward for long‐term sustained results in nonsurgical rhinomodelation. Expert injection techniques and knowing the side effects and handling them is mandatory.
